TBILISI. March 9 (Interfax-AVN) - The United States supports Georgian settlement efforts in Abkhazia and South Ossetia and hopes Russia will intensify its efforts as well, U.S. Deputy Assistant Secretary of State for European and Eurasian Affairs Matthew Bryza said after a Thursday meeting with Georgian Deputy State Minister for Separatist Conflicts Giorgi Volsky.
Georgia is taking steps toward the settlement, he said. The authority of Georgia in Europe is improving day by day, and the United States hopes that European assistance will speed up the settlement process, he said.
The United States would like Russia to share Georgia's enthusiasm and take active steps in the settlement process, Bryza said.
"Georgia and the United States have the same position on the settlement. We want Russia to share this position," Volsky said.
